Wzone
=====

Wzone is a package for generating zones of armed conflicts. The package contains functionalities 
for querying and creating conflict zones in the `ESRI ASCII raster format`_. The methodological details
can be found `here`_ (TBD). The package greatly relies on the UCDPGED (version 17.1) compiled by
the `Uppsala Conflict Data Program`_.

An Example
----------------

.. code-block:: python

    import wzone
    import tempfile

    # list of UCDPGED conflict IDs relevant to state-based violence in Somalia
    somalia_ids = wzone.find_ids(country='Somalia', type_of_violence=1)   ### [329, 337, 418, 13646]

    # Yearly sequence of dates from the first to the last events for each conflict
    somalia_dates = wzone.find_dates(ids=somalia_ids, interval='year')   ### somalia_dates[1][0] == '1989-01-01'

    # select a test case
    test_id = 337
    test_date = '2010-01-01'

    # create war zones
    tmp_dir = tempfile.mkdtemp()
    somalia_path = wzone.gen_wzones(dates=test_date, ids=test_id, out_dir=tmp_dir)
    print somalia_path

    # You can continue this example with a variety of functions in other GIS packages.
    ### For arcpy users, refer to arcpy.ASCIIToRaster_conversion function.
    ### For gdal users, refer to gdal.Open function.
